Output 66a058d2630512c25c8e30935388ba2dd5ed4014d01052cb05d73a0152af654a:0

value
40826999
script pubkey
OP_0 OP_PUSHBYTES_20 3120b82429b6f8212f40aaad6c89a4b458915f7b
address
ltc1qxystsfpfkmuzzt6q42kkezdyk3vfzhmmns2pdq
transaction
66a058d2630512c25c8e30935388ba2dd5ed4014d01052cb05d73a0152af654a
spent
true